    Apparently the related posts images are an added image size that by definition is cropped to fit a certain aspect so all posts in a row will display uniformly regardless of the source image’s actual aspect. Altering this behavior could have adverse effects on the overall appearance unless you are very disciplined and consistent with what images you upload. It should be feasible to alter the aspect ratio used for all related posts, but I don’t advise altering the cropping behavior.

    It looks like the related posts feature is part of JetPack. I recommend asking in their dedicated support forum how you might be able to get what you want.
